Creating a Lye Solution: A Comprehensive Guide to Safety and Preparation

Lye, also known as sodium hydroxide (NaOH), is a highly caustic substance commonly used in various industries, including soap making, paper production, and water treatment. When working with lye, it’s essential to exercise extreme caution and follow proper safety protocols to avoid severe burns and other injuries. In this article, we’ll delve into the process of creating a lye solution, emphasizing the importance of safety and providing a step-by-step guide on how to prepare this potent substance.

Understanding Lye and Its Uses

Before we dive into the process of creating a lye solution, it’s crucial to understand what lye is and its various applications. Lye is a highly alkaline substance with a pH level of around 14. It’s commonly used in:

  • Soap making: Lye is used to create the base of soap, which is then mixed with oils and fats to produce a mild and cleansing product.
  • Paper production: Lye is used to break down wood pulp and create paper products.
  • Water treatment: Lye is used to raise the pH level of water and remove impurities.
  • Cleaning products: Lye is used in various cleaning products, such as drain cleaners and oven cleaners.

Step-by-Step Guide to Creating a Lye Solution

Creating a lye solution is a relatively straightforward process, but it requires caution and attention to detail. Here’s a step-by-step guide on how to create a lye solution:

Step 1: Prepare the Mixing Container

Before you start mixing the lye solution, make sure the mixing container is clean and dry. If you’re using a glass container, ensure it’s heat-resistant and won’t shatter when exposed to high temperatures.

Step 2: Measure the Lye and Water

Measure the lye and water carefully, using a digital scale and a measuring cup. The ratio of lye to water will depend on the specific application, but a common ratio is 1 part lye to 3 parts water.

Step 3: Slowly Add the Lye to the Water

Slowly add the lye to the water, stirring constantly with a heat-resistant stirring rod. Avoid splashing the mixture, as this can cause the lye to come into contact with your skin.

Step 4: Monitor the Temperature

Use a thermometer to monitor the temperature of the solution. The temperature will rise rapidly as the lye dissolves, so it’s essential to monitor it closely.

Step 5: Stir the Solution

Continue stirring the solution until the lye is fully dissolved. This can take several minutes, depending on the ratio of lye to water.
